Describe the nitrogen cycle

A
  1. Nitrogen in the air is absorbed by nitrogen fixing bacteria
  2. This is turned into nitrate and amino acids are released into the plants which is then eaten by the animals
  3. When these organisms die the DECOMPOSING BACTERIA break them down into ammonia and the NITRIFYING BACTERIA break it down back into nitrates and the cycle repeats again

Why can crop rotation increase crop yield? ( explain )

A

Farmers firstly grow crops in their fields that contain NITROGEN FIXING BACTERIA in their roots so the plants can absorb the nitrates and increase the concentration
The following year the farmer grows their normal crop and they absorb the nitrogen from the NITROGEN FIXING PLANTS increasing crop yield
